My two daughters have used the new ghost for warmups and I do not see much of a difference in the bat from the GA. It is a huge improvement from the previous 5 stamp ghost and both say it feels more like the GA and definitely hits more like the GA than the old 5 stamp.

As for the talk on the Meta now coming alive after 500 swings. I understand bats, non ghost, need much longer break in periods but i think the big key here is are we talking okay it is like the LXT and Xeno where a perfectly squared up ball is getting over the fence and the bat is a LS hammer like they typically have? Or is it approaching the ghost effect and jumping off the barrel so hard and fast that infielders have less reaction times and improves the batting average. I think this is the truest test since I believe a hard hit ball that is a homerun is a homerun with the majority of the top end bats these days, the difference maker is how the ball is coming off on the line drives and hard ground balls since these are where the majority of girls are hitting.

I think the Meta ultimately wont convert the ghost users but i see it converting a ton of demarini users. the only question i foresee is, do the xeno lovers find a way to embrace the meta or will they look elsewhere to find a more over weight slight end loaded bat to replace their now deceased xeno bat in the future?
